CIIC:Today's featured article/June 13, 2018


Jump to: navigation, search
Mount Emei

Mount Emei (峨眉山), located in Sichuan Province, is one of the four holy mountains of Chinese Buddhism. It is regarded as the domain of Samantabhadra, or Bodhisattva of Universal Benevolence, depicted as riding upon an elephant. (More...)

Personal tools